Good Oral Hygiene

 

 

Maintain good oral hygiene is foremost important than using methods for natural teeth whitening at home. If you are using such methods for teeth whitening at home without taking care of your oral hygiene, you’ll not get satisfactory results. Brushing and flossing your teeth regularly after every meal prevents the buildup of bacteria and plaque.

Try to use fluoride toothpaste which according to dentists is good for teeth and prevents its premature decay. You can also go for regular dental checkups so if any disease is spotted incidentally must be treated on time to prevents further complications.

Strawberry Whitens Teeth

 

 

Everything that contains malic acid is the best remedy to fast teeth whitening DIY. Strawberries contain malic acid in a great quantity. This is best used to remove some heavy stains from teeth. These stains include coffee, wine, and tea stains and yellow stains from teeth.

To prepare strawberry tooth whitener you just have to simply mash or crush 3 to 4 strawberries and add about 1 spoon of baking soda. You must mix them thoroughly so that a mixture forms. This mixture should be applied on a soft brush which can reach out in all directions of your teeth. Your teeth must be brushed with this quick teeth whitening DIY trick for about 7 to 8 minutes. After this, you must try flossing out your teeth to remove any strawberries from your teeth.

These are the DIY teeth whitening that actually works but in this case also you cannot use it on daily basis it is recommended that you use it after every two months after a regular use of three to four days as acid of any kind can damage tooth enamel so it’s best that you get regular cleaning easily.

Oil Pulling

 

 

Oil pulling is the best home remedy for teeth whitening. This is one of the most inexpensive and the best home remedy for whitening teeth on can use for himself. You just have to take a sip or two of organic oil and rinse it for about 20 minutes. Allow it to pass through your teeth and gums and spit it out afterward. Rinse your mouth thoroughly with water after this oil pulling process. You should also drink up to 3 glass of boiled, purified water after rinsing to make sure that no particles remain in between your teeth and the oily feeling wears from your mouth.
